The Advantages of Remote Servers for Business Performance

Remote servers offer a wide range of advantages that can significantly enhance business performance. One of the most notable benefits is the enhanced scalability and flexibility they provide. Businesses can easily scale their server resources up or down as needed, adapting to fluctuating demands without the need for significant upfront investments in hardware. This flexibility allows businesses to respond quickly to market changes and seize new opportunities.

Another significant advantage of remote servers is their ability to improve security and reliability. By outsourcing server management to specialized providers, businesses can benefit from robust security measures and advanced disaster recovery protocols. These providers invest heavily in infrastructure and security, ensuring that data is protected from cyber threats and other potential risks. This enhanced security can significantly reduce the risk of data breaches and downtime, which can be detrimental to business operations.

The Challenges of Remote Servers for Business Performance

While remote servers offer numerous advantages, they also present certain challenges that businesses need to consider. One of the primary concerns is the potential for latency issues. Since data needs to travel over longer distances, there is a risk of increased latency, which can affect the speed and responsiveness of applications. This can be particularly problematic for businesses that rely on real-time data processing or have geographically dispersed teams.

Another challenge associated with remote servers is the potential for dependency on third-party providers. Businesses that rely on remote servers are essentially outsourcing their IT infrastructure, which can create a degree of dependence on the service provider. This dependence can be problematic if the provider experiences technical difficulties or outages, which can disrupt business operations.

Mitigating the Challenges of Remote Servers

Despite the challenges, businesses can mitigate the risks associated with remote servers by taking proactive steps. One crucial step is to carefully select a reputable and reliable service provider. Businesses should conduct thorough research and due diligence to ensure that the provider has a proven track record of delivering high-quality services and maintaining robust security measures.

Another important step is to implement appropriate monitoring and management tools. By closely monitoring server performance and proactively addressing any issues, businesses can minimize the impact of latency and other potential problems. Regular backups and disaster recovery plans are also essential to ensure business continuity in the event of unforeseen circumstances.
